Output 24f8183a9008adf041acd3c75fb3bf711581e116962aac8ca1443e73acbb8215:0

value
21688353
script pubkey
OP_0 OP_PUSHBYTES_20 d8e34eeacd3a0b93ae04d014e66080bf93d22e2e
address
bc1qmr35a6kd8g9e8tsy6q2wvcyqh7fayt3wcx22mp
transaction
24f8183a9008adf041acd3c75fb3bf711581e116962aac8ca1443e73acbb8215